What they do

A Substitute Teacher teaches or supervises classes for teachers who are away on leave or sick. May substitute for teachers at several different schools or school districts. May substitute for one day or for a longer term absence; may follow lesson plans developed by the regular teacher, or work with teacher who will be out to create new lesson plans and assignments.

$34,477 / year median in Tennessee

+17% projected growth
